Latest Patents
Forter holds a patent for a "Digital/analog closed caption display system in a television signal receiver." This invention allows a digital television signal receiver to process both digital and analog auxiliary information contained in a digital television signal. The system ensures that users can access closed captioning information, regardless of whether it is provided in a digital or analog format. This capability is particularly beneficial when a digital program signal lacks digital closed captioning, as the receiver automatically processes any available analog auxiliary information.
